A Modern Software Developer: Mastering Modern Software Development

In today's dynamic software development landscape, the need for adaptability is paramount. The conventional waterfall model fails to keep up with the ever-changing expectations of modern software. This is where the Agile programmer stands out.

Agile development prioritizes iterative processes, close collaboration with stakeholders, and a dedication to delivering results in short, manageable iterations.

The Agile programmer is not simply a developer; they are a thinker who can rapidly adapt to changing requirements, team up effectively, and continuously learn and improve.

By embracing Agile values, the modern programmer can become a true master of their craft.
